DetailsPackages like MythTV require that qt be compiled with mysql support, which it isn't by default. Since Arch is otherwise so ideal a platform for MythTV, it would be nice to have the flexibility without having to rebuild a fairly key system component like qt.
Patch to the PKGBUILD is attached. |

I'd get a lot of complaining desktop users if I make qt depend on mysql.
I'll experiment with some other programs that use qt and try to determine their behavior with mysql removed, and then report back here.
